In a world deeply influenced by technology, I Am Q presents a compelling exploration of the human condition. Covering contemporary topics like social networks, privacy rights and corporate responsibility, this story encourages readers to question the impact of technological progress on our lives, relationships, and society.
Narrated through the lens of Sam Noble, a white-collar worker grappling with the consequences of technological advancement, I Am Q explores how the rapid rise of progress has influenced our daily lives. The book captures the essence of the Bridge Generation - individuals who straddle the divide between pre and post-internet eras, bringing them together to discuss and reflect upon the evolution of technology.

Seeking Human Connections
These were the words inscribed on a business card left for Sam Noble at a dimly lit bar in Manhattan.
There was nothing extraordinary about the life of Sam Noble. As a freelance content writer for commercial products and a mediocre standup comedian, Sam succumbed to a life of complacency. That is, until he met Q.
A complex woman in her twenties suffering from acute bone-marrow disease, Q maintains an unorthodox lifestyle under the protective wings of her parents. After a series of fateful events immerses Q into Sam’s life, he is contracted by a high-tech enterprise to teach Q about the human connection.
During these intimate sessions with Q, ancient ruins of Sam’s own past become unearthed, unraveling a dialogue that reflects on the influence of technology in our lives. Starting somewhere before the modem and ending around selfie-sticks, Sam’s lessons shed light on the subtle advancements of technology, demanding his astute pupil to question progress.
But never did he imagine how far these lessons would take them — from discovering unknown truths about his own identity, to confronting greater forces of progress in acts of martyrdom.
